India, May 11 -- Tamil Nadu's new Chief Minister Vijay on Monday met his predecessor and DMK chief MK Stalin, a day after the actor-turned-politician was sworn in following a landmark election victory.
The meeting marked Vijay's first interaction with Stalin after winning the Assembly elections and assuming office as chief minister, with the visit being described as a " call". Stalin and his son, Udhayanidhi Stalin, extended a warm welcome to the new chief minister.
Udhayanidhi greeted Vijay with a handshake and a hug upon his arrival, while Stalin later embraced him as well. The two leaders also exchanged silk shawls and bouquets during the meeting.
